Transaction 1868e752052a4f34436515110610139370af592005824144f91f9f79a44c730e
1 Input
2 Outputs
- 1868e752052a4f34436515110610139370af592005824144f91f9f79a44c730e:0
- 1868e752052a4f34436515110610139370af592005824144f91f9f79a44c730e:1
value 600000
address 3LbRtBD2KrJq6ZhFxLTNHT9NWhY6ZxwUZe
value 4348147
address 1Ccp5pusJqdorvdaap6JVePJBhRx7h7sb3